From d83697f4f0f44b4d853e095511254ee6aeefeb01 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Ian Lance Taylor Date: Wed, 26 Sep 2012 12:38:08 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] Makefile.def: Make all-gcc depend on all-libbacktrace. ./: * Makefile.def: Make all-gcc depend on all-libbacktrace. * Makefile.in: Rebuild. gcc/: * diagnostic.c: Include "demangle.h" and "backtrace.h". (bt_stop): New static array. (bt_callback, bt_err_callback): New static functions. (diagnostic_action_after_output): Call backtrace_full for DK_ICE. * Makefile.in (BACKTRACE): New variable. (BACKTRACEINC, LIBBACKTRACE): New variables. (BACKTRACE_H): New variable. (LIBDEPS, LIBS): Add $(LIBBACKTRACE). (INCLUDES): Add $(BACKTRACEINC). (diagnostic.o): Depend upon $(DEMANGLE_H) and $(BACKTRACE_H).
